What they do

A Data Center Technician or Engineer organizes data access, maintenance and access support to a data center. Maybe help to store and organize data, such as an organization's records or financial information. Ensures that users can easily access the information they need and that data are protected from unauthorized access.

Lead rack-and-stack of GPU servers, switches, and storage at colocation and modular data center sites Cable compute, storage, and high-speed networking (InfiniBand and high-speed Ethernet) per the approved design Power on, configure BMC/iLO/iDRAC, and execute firmware/BIOS bring-up Run burn-in tests including memory, GPU stress, NCCL, and benchmark sweeps Coordinate with NOC and Platform Engineering on cluster bring-up and acceptance What's Needed? 4+ years in data center field engineering, deployment engineering, or systems integration Strong hands-on hardware experience with servers, top-of-rack switches, and storage Proficiency with structured cabling, power distribution, and DCIM tools Willingness and ability to travel up to 50% Ability to lift up to 50 lbs and work standing or in confined spaces in a data center environment What's in it for me?
